Critic Reviews


Simon Hopkinson Guardian
Reviewed by September 06, 2008
"The dinner menu prices can reach stratospheric heights, but if you have the wherewithal, at least choose the ethereally delicious soufflé Suissesse. It was on that menu in 1974 and remains on this one today." READ REVIEW
Critic's score: 10
Marina O'Loughlin Metro
Reviewed on May 23, 2007
"So why is Le Gavroche still packing them in? Because, dodgy decor notwithstanding, it's a class act. Because it delivers food you really want to eat. Because you come out feeling pampered and privileged and full. And because that's a whole lot of rich people's idea of fun." READ REVIEW
Critic's score: 8
AA Gill Sunday Times
Reviewed on October 09, 2005
"The menu is proper old French, of the type you would have difficulty finding in Paris now. They only eat like this in Vichy." READ REVIEW

Giles Coren Times
Reviewed on September 06, 2003
"It is everything you would have wanted in a restaurant: serious, dedicated, frivol-free and patient." READ REVIEW
Critic's score: 9.5
